I didn’t know what to expect from this airline: Biman Bangladesh Airlines. I had a 23hr layover in Dhaka from Nepal and going to Myanmar. During the flight they gave us bottle water and a bottle of coke. Whoa! The food was a little weird. I think it was a sweet tuna sandwich and this pudding dessert with small noodles? And a cupcake. I wasn’t too hungry since I scarfed down some chicken momos at the Kathmandu airport before boarding. Now that was good! It was kinda weird being in a plane filled with 95% men. Who stared. It was a little better in the airport but still it was primarily men.
The reps for the airline told me that it would cost $51 to put me in a hotel and get a transit visa. No thanks. They instead fed me dinner, breakfast and lunch.
The airport stays open all night. That was weird. At 6am I went into the only coffee shop and basically stayed there for 6 hours charging my Surface and phone. There is unlimited free wifi! If it weren’t for all the mosquitoes… Also the Cricket world cup (?) has been airing on all the flat screens and this morning Bangladesh was playing against New Zealand and it entertaining hearing cheers and groans all day. I of course don’t understand cricket so I just uploaded photos on FB and updating this blog.
I also woke up knowing that my lips were bitten twice because it definitely felt swollen. Now that was weird... my left hand has 9 bites =[ actually there were 15 when I counted after my shower in Myanmar.
I recently found out that this airport is used by the Bangladesh Air Force which made perfect sense seeing all the men in combat uniforms with guns strapped on their backs. Seriously, they were everywhere.
